That Grand Word, "Whosoever"

Eliza E. Hewitt • English

Primary Scripture: John 3:16

Verse 1

That grand word “whosoever” is ringing thro’ my soul, Whosoever will may come; In rivers of salvation the living waters roll, Whosoever will may come.

Chorus

O that “whosoever”! Whosoever will may come; The Saviour’s invitation is freely sounding still, Whosoever will may come.

Verse 2

Whenever this sweet message in God’s own word I see, Whosoever will may come; I know ’tis meant for sinners, I know ’tis meant for me, Whosoever will may come.

Chorus

O that “whosoever”! Whosoever will may come; The Saviour’s invitation is freely sounding still, Whosoever will may come.

Verse 3

I heard the loving message, and now to others say, Whosoever will may come; Seek now the precious Saviour, and he’ll be yours today, Whosoever will may come.

Chorus

O that “whosoever”! Whosoever will may come; The Saviour’s invitation is freely sounding still, Whosoever will may come.

Verse 4

To God be all the glory! his only Son he gave, Whosoever will may come; And those who come believing, he’ll to the utmost save, Whosoever will may come.

Chorus

O that “whosoever”! Whosoever will may come; The Saviour’s invitation is freely sounding still, Whosoever will may come.
